How does Des Plaines's winter climate affect concrete mix and prep selection?

In Des Plaines's cold-climate market: Standard concrete in Des Plaines runs $6-10 per square foot for basic flatwork (driveways, walkways). Decorative options (stamped, colored, exposed aggregate) add $4-8 per square foot. The biggest hidden cost is demolition and removal of existing concrete — budget $2-4 per square foot for tearout of old slabs.

What red flags should I watch for hiring a concrete contractor in Des Plaines?

Be cautious of concrete work contractors in Des Plaines who pressure you to sign same-day. Legitimate contractors expect you to get competing bids and will hold their price for 30 days. High-pressure sales tactics correlate with inflated pricing. Any Des Plaines contractor who asks for more than 30% upfront before materials are ordered is a red flag. Standard practice is 10-15% deposit, materials-on-delivery payment, and final payment on completion.
